A hybrid method for evaluating absorbed solar energy at the surface level using remote sensing data

Maxim A. Yakunin

Altai state university, Krasnoarmeiskiy, 90, Barnaul, 695049, Russia

Abstract: A new method to evaluate the solar energy absorbed by the surface using remote sensing data and the method of basic spectra is presented. The proposed method allows one to calculate parameters of radiation transferring in the atmosphere without being related to specific satellite instruments or areas.

Keywords: basic spectra method, remote sensing, transmittance, aerosol optical thickness, total precipitable water, absorbed solar energy.
